Goldwin was established in 1950 as a humble knitwear factory in the Toyama region of Japan. Today, the brand manufactures for Helly Hanson JP, The North Face Purple Lable, Woolrich JP, and Nanamica.

Sharing the same design team as Nanamica. Goldwin's mission statement is slightly different, as designer Eiichrio Homma states. 

"Goldwin is a sportswear company that produces highly functional garments for specific purposes, such as backpacking, climbing, swimming, and running. Their value lies in creating the ultimate quality for specific objectives. While they make technical sportswear that looks cool for everyday use, it’s designed without compromise for actual sports performance."
